# M6.4 — Go-native `/payments` page (grouped-by-person ledger)
> Plan-mode note: per project convention this plan should live at
> `docs/plans/2026-05-08-1220-go-m6-4-payments-page.md`. The first execution
> step after approval is to copy this file there.
## Context
The Go port of the Flask app is at milestone **M6.4**: replace the placeholder
`/payments` template ([go/internal/web/templates/payments.tmpl](go/internal/web/templates/payments.tmpl))
with a feature-equivalent grouped-by-person ledger view, matching the Python
[templates/payments.html](templates/payments.html) page.
Compared to M6.2 (`/adults`) and M6.3 (`/juniors`), this page is **structurally
much simpler**:
- No filters (no name input, no month-range selects).
- No totals / credits / debts / unmatched-as-extra-section.
- No JS (no `filters.js`, no modal — modal is M6.5 territory and Python's
payments page itself has none).
- No QR / Pay buttons.
- Single grouping dimension: **by person**, sorted alphabetically, with a
synthetic `"Unmatched / Unknown"` bucket appended.
- Each person's transactions sorted **newest-first**.
- Columns: Date, Amount (right-aligned, green), Purpose, Bank Message.
The JSON API side is already done (`/api/payments` at
[go/internal/web/api/handler.go:78-86](go/internal/web/api/handler.go#L78-L86)),
returning a `PaymentsResponse{ GroupedPayments, SortedPeople, AttendanceURL,
PaymentsURL }`. The HTML side just needs to consume it.
## Approach
Mirror the M6.2/M6.3 pattern: extract an `AssembleX(ctx)` method, add a typed
`PageData` wrapper, render a real template, lift the page-specific CSS into the
shared stylesheet.
### 1. Extract `AssemblePayments(ctx) (PaymentsResponse, error)`
In [go/internal/web/api/handler.go](go/internal/web/api/handler.go), refactor
`ServePayments` (currently inlines the load+build at lines 78-86) to mirror
`AssembleAdults` / `AssembleJuniors`:
```go
func (h *Handler) ServePayments(w http.ResponseWriter, r *http.Request) {
resp, err := h.AssemblePayments(r.Context())
if err != nil { h.writeError(w, r, err); return }
writeJSON(w, resp)
}
func (h *Handler) AssemblePayments(ctx context.Context) (PaymentsResponse, error) {
txns, err := h.Sources.LoadTransactions(ctx)
if err != nil { return PaymentsResponse{}, fmt.Errorf("load transactions: %w", err) }
return buildPaymentsResponse(txns, h.allMemberNames(ctx)), nil
}
```
Pure refactor — `make parity` should report zero diffs on `/api/payments`.

Notes:
- `printf "%.0f"` matches the visual style of integer CZK amounts (Python prints
the float as-is, but bank-row amounts are always whole CZK). If the user
prefers exact Python parity (`750.0 CZK`), drop the `printf` and use
`{{$tx.Amount}}`.
- Iterating a `map` requires using `.Data.SortedPeople` to drive order then
`index $.Data.GroupedPayments $person` — Go templates don't preserve map
insertion order.
